Nevertheless, soil biological indicators are still underrepresented in soil quality assessments and mostly limited to black-box measurements such as microbial biomass and …This study examined the influence of heat exposure on DNA samples during polymerase chain reaction (PCR) detection. In this study, λDNA samples, as model DNA, were exposed to 105°C for 3-90 minutes or to 105°C-115°C for 15 minutes by autoclaving. The exposed samples were subjected to real-time PCR using nine primer sets with amplicon sizes of 45-504 bp. 1) air with CO2 & O2 go in through stoma. 2) inside mesophyll cells: CO2 (1C) & PEP (3C) are combined using PEP carboxylase to create oxaloacetate (4C) 3) then it goes into malate (4C) 4) transfer malate to the bundle sheath cells which do not have direct access to the air. 5) create pyruvate >> back to PEP.
